I left Aus at the end of september (moved to Canada). I was on a 457 visa.

I recently tried to use the online application to release my superanuation as a cash payment.

However, it seems that my Visa has not yet been cancelled.(which needs to happen before you can claim your super) Does anyone know how soon an employer is obligated to inform immigration? and then how long it takes for immigration to cancel your visa. It has been a month now and it seems I still have an active visa.

DIAC should be informed as soon as possible and then the visa cancellation takes 28 days I believe. Just give it a bit longer.

(I presume that you could just as easily tell DIAC just to make sure).
